Main Control Area
At the heart of the control panel is the main control area. This section houses the most critical controls for the grinder's operation. The power switch, which is prominently placed, is the first point of interaction for starting and stopping the machine. A large, illuminated button makes it easy to see and operate, even in low - light conditions.
Next to the power switch, there are controls for the engine. These include the throttle control, which allows operators to adjust the engine speed according to the specific grinding task. Whether it's a light - duty job that requires a lower speed or a heavy - duty task that demands maximum power, the throttle control provides precise adjustment.
Feed System Controls
The feed system is an essential part of the horizontal grinder, and its controls are conveniently located on the control panel. There are separate controls for the in - feed conveyor and the feed wheel. The in - feed conveyor control allows operators to start, stop, and adjust the speed of the conveyor that brings the material into the grinder. This is crucial for maintaining a consistent flow of material and preventing overloading.


The feed wheel control, on the other hand, manages the rotation of the feed wheel that pushes the material into the grinding chamber. Operators can control the direction and speed of the feed wheel, ensuring that the material is fed smoothly and efficiently.
Grinding Chamber Controls
The grinding chamber controls are designed to optimize the grinding process. There is a control for the rotor speed, which can be adjusted to achieve different levels of grinding fineness. Higher rotor speeds are suitable for finer grinding, while lower speeds may be used for coarser grinding or when dealing with tougher materials.
In addition, there are controls for the screen selection. The Hm6420 Horizontal Grinder comes with multiple screens of different sizes, and the control panel allows operators to easily switch between them. This flexibility enables the grinder to produce a wide range of output sizes, from large chips to fine mulch.
Safety Controls
Safety is of utmost importance in any industrial machinery, and the Hm6420's control panel is equipped with several safety controls. There is an emergency stop button, which is a large, red button located prominently on the panel. In case of an emergency, operators can quickly press this button to immediately stop all machine operations.
There are also safety sensors and indicators on the control panel. These sensors monitor various aspects of the machine, such as temperature, pressure, and belt tension. If any abnormal conditions are detected, the corresponding indicator lights will illuminate, alerting the operator to take appropriate action.
Monitoring and Diagnostic Section
The control panel also features a monitoring and diagnostic section. This section displays real - time information about the machine's performance, such as engine temperature, oil pressure, and fuel level. Operators can keep a close eye on these parameters to ensure that the machine is operating within safe limits.
In addition, the diagnostic system can detect and display error codes. If a problem occurs, the error code will be shown on the panel, along with a brief description of the issue. This helps technicians quickly identify and troubleshoot problems, minimizing downtime.
